SR155C331KAATR2 Equivalent & Substitute Parts
Part Overview
The SR155C331KAATR2 is a 330 pF ceramic capacitor rated at 50V with X7R temperature coefficient, manufactured by KYOCERA AVX in the SkyCap® SR series. This through-hole radial component is designed for general-purpose applications requiring stable capacitance across the operating temperature range of -55°C to 125°C. The part is currently active and in stock with RoHS3 compliance. Substitute Part Grouping Explanation
Substitution eligibility for the SR155C331KAATR2 is determined by matching the following electrical and mechanical parameters:
- Capacitance value: 330 pF
- Tolerance: ±10%
- Voltage rating: 50V minimum
- Temperature coefficient: X7R
- Operating temperature range: -55°C to 125°C minimum
- Mounting type: Through Hole
- Package type: Radial
Physical dimensions, lead spacing, and lead style variations are permitted within the constraints of the application's PCB layout and assembly process. All substitute parts must maintain RoHS3 compliance and active product status.

Engineering Selection Recommendations
All listed substitute parts meet the core electrical requirements for direct functional replacement of the SR155C331KAATR2. Selection among substitutes should be based on:
Lead Spacing Compatibility: The SR155C331KAATR2 features 0.100" (2.54mm) lead spacing. The K331K15X7RF5TL2 maintains this spacing with straight leads, providing the closest mechanical match for direct PCB hole alignment. The K331K15X7RF5TH5 and RDER71H331K0K1H03B feature 0.197" (5.00mm) lead spacing and require PCB layout modification.
Lead Style: The SR155C331KAATR2 uses straight leads. The K331K15X7RF5TL2 also features straight leads. The K331K15X7RF5TH5 and RDER71H331K0K1H03B use formed or kinked leads, which may require different insertion and soldering procedures.
Height Clearance: The SR155C331KAATR2 has a maximum seated height of 0.150" (3.81mm). Substitute parts range from 0.220" to 0.260" in height. Verify clearance in applications with height constraints.
Packaging and Inventory: K331K15X7RF5TL2 offers the highest inventory availability (33,820 pcs) in Cut Tape packaging. RDER71H331K0K1H03B is available in Bulk packaging (1,441 pcs). All parts maintain active product status and RoHS3 compliance.

Q: What is the difference between Cut Tape and Bulk packaging?
A: Cut Tape (CT) packaging is supplied on continuous tape cut to specific lengths, suitable for automated assembly. Bulk packaging contains loose components. Packaging selection depends on assembly process requirements and inventory management practices.
